use the quadratic formula to solve the equation. round your solution to the nearest hundredth x^2+6x-10=0

OpenStudy (johnweldon1993):

Okay, so quadratic formula lol \[\large \frac{-b \pm \sqrt{b^2 - 4ac}}{2a}\]

OpenStudy (johnweldon1993):

The equation x^2 + 6x - 10 = 0 We have a = 1 b = 6 c = -10 So plug all those into the quadratic equation \[\large \frac{-6 \pm \sqrt{6^2 - 4(1)(-10)}}{2(1)}\]

OpenStudy (johnweldon1993):

Simplify it a little bit \[\large \frac{-6 \pm \sqrt{36 - (-40)}}{2}\]

OpenStudy (johnweldon1993):

\[\large \frac{-6 \pm \sqrt{76}}{2}\] Soo now...what is the square root of 76?

OpenStudy (johnweldon1993):

Okay, so we have \[\large \frac{-6 \pm 8.717797887081348}{2}\] *sorry just wrote it out lol Now break that into 2 equations \(\large \frac{-6 + 8.717797887081348}{2}\) and \(\large \frac{-6 - 8.717797887081348}{2}\) solve those both and you're good :)
